摘要

In extending our studies involving BF_3.Et_2O-catalyzed reaction of cinnamic acid analogues, we have shown that amido derivatives also can afford [4]resorcinarene octamethyl ethers. Subse- quently, chiral monomeric amides, derived from the mixed anhydride of cinnamic acid and L- or D-valine, upon treatment with BF_3.Et_2O, yielded for the first time chiral amido [4]resorcinarenes In enantiomerically pure forms. Four stereoisomers were isolated, and three of them were attributed The flattened-cone, chair, and 1,2-alternate conformations.
